Applications are now open for the Perspective Fund Documentary Film Support 2026, an opportunity designed to support documentary filmmakers and narrative strategists who are closest to the issues their films address and are uniquely positioned to create meaningful social impact.
The Perspective Fund invests in documentary projects that have the potential to expand public understanding, shape culture, strengthen movements, and contribute to systems change. Rather than supporting films solely for artistic merit, the fund prioritizes projects that can influence public discourse, advance advocacy efforts, and create lasting societal impact.
The program recognizes the power of storytelling as a tool for change and seeks filmmakers whose work can contribute something distinct and valuable to ongoing efforts in journalism, advocacy, movement building, and public life.
For documentary filmmakers seeking support to advance impactful storytelling, the Perspective Fund offers an important opportunity to receive funding and strategic backing.
About the Perspective Fund
The Perspective Fund supports documentary filmmakers and narrative strategists whose projects address critical social, political, environmental, cultural, and economic issues.
The fund focuses on stories that can:
- Expand public understanding.
- Influence culture and public dialogue.
- Strengthen social movements.
- Advance advocacy efforts.
- Drive systems-level change.
- Support public-interest storytelling.
Unlike traditional film grants that primarily evaluate artistic production, the Perspective Fund places strong emphasis on impact, community accountability, strategic clarity, and issue expertise.

What the Perspective Fund Looks For
The Perspective Fund evaluates applicants across multiple dimensions to identify projects with the greatest potential for impact.
1. Strategic Clarity
Applicants should demonstrate a clear understanding of:
- What they are creating.
- Why the project matters.
- Who the project serves.
- The change the project aims to achieve.
Strong projects have a well-defined vision and strategy for impact.
2. Community Accountability and Power
The fund prioritizes filmmakers who maintain authentic relationships with the communities represented in their work.
Projects should demonstrate:
- Ethical storytelling practices.
- Community engagement.
- Respect for participants and stakeholders.
- Accountability to affected communities.
3. Issue Expertise and Landscape Awareness
Applicants should show a deep understanding of the issue they are addressing.
This includes:
- Knowledge of existing efforts.
- Understanding of relevant stakeholders.
- Awareness of policy, advocacy, and movement landscapes.
- Familiarity with current narratives surrounding the issue.
4. Narrative Impact
The Perspective Fund seeks stories capable of shifting perspectives and influencing public conversations.
Projects should have the potential to:
- Reach key audiences.
- Challenge existing assumptions.
- Introduce new perspectives.
- Generate meaningful dialogue.
5. Contribution to Broader Change
Projects should demonstrate how the documentary can support broader efforts already underway within movements, journalism, advocacy, or public life.
The strongest applications clearly explain how storytelling will contribute to existing change-making efforts.

Application Process
Interested applicants should complete the official inquiry form and provide information about:
- Their documentary project.
- Intended impact goals.
- Community engagement approach.
- Issue expertise.
- Strategic vision.
- Storytelling objectives.
Applicants are encouraged to clearly demonstrate both creative excellence and impact potential.
